IFAB Approval of Modifications to Law 4 - Head Covers
2014-03-26
IFAB Law 4-Head covers
Head covers for male and female players formally permitted after two-year trial period; display of any slogans, statements, images and advertising prohibited on undergarments.

The International Football Association Board (IFAB), at its Annual General Meeting on 1 March 2014, approved the modifications to the interpretation of ‘Law 4 – the Players’ Equipment’ specifying the provisions by which male and female players can now wear head covers.
The modifications are in accordance with previous directives issued by the Canadian Soccer Association and FIFA regarding this matter.
